At the release, my opponent was spitting flashers with two of this guy and a Deceiver Exarch, making combat hell for me. I subsequently overvalued the card the first time I played the new format. It's definitely a fine card, main-deckable all the way, but not by any means an early pick. The format is fast enough that you're not going to be able to leave enough mana up to defend using this guy at instant speed, so combat shenanigans, which are what would make this guy an earlier pick, are out the window. Wait until about 8th pick.
